 Debo decir que me encanta cómo escribe. La ambientación es espectacular.
Me ha dado miedo en ocasiones, cosa que no me esperaba en absoluto, pero muy muy bien.
Se lee a gran velocidad porque el misterio te engancha y los capítulos cortos siempre te hacen pensar "sólo uno más antes de dormir" y de pronto son las cuatro de la mañana.


Es cierto que el final se me ha quedado un poco ahí ahí, porque siendo sincera, era lo que esperaba desde el principio.
Igual si no hubiese leído ya algún libro donde la historia escrita en un diario fuese inventada, me habría sorprendido más, pero desde el mismo principio estaba sospechando.
Realmente yo pensaba que quizá incluso la biografía la había escrito el marido, que me pareció muy sospechoso, sobre todo porque toda la autobiografía estaba muy centrada en su pene.
Cosa que también aclara Verity en su carta "no estaba tan obsesionada", la verdad me hizo gracia.

A todo esto, estoy ignorando el supuesto capítulo extra. No existe. Fin de la discusión.
Me gusta el final abierto tal cual está porque tú decides al final quién dice la verdad y es muy interesante, porque "qué razones hay para creer a Verity? Qué razones hay para no hacerlo??"

Podemos hablar de lo creepy que es el niño sin necesidad??? No, en serio, pensé que incluso era psicópata con las escenas de los cuchillos...
 
 

En fin, que yo creo que le doy 3,5 estrellas, no está malote, pero le ha faltado un algo. 

Y sí lo recomiendo mucho, porque se pasa un buen rato. No es el mejor thriller que he leído, pero la pasé bien.
